Transaction 25fec32589ddf1a14da0eb43fc7ed183d59bc9c788a2ef3664c2839d1ff09eff

1 Input
2 Outputs
  • 25fec32589ddf1a14da0eb43fc7ed183d59bc9c788a2ef3664c2839d1ff09eff:0
  • value  1511630
    address  1FTZE5AC7DKUmCXDXWxidwGktAwk2PDCBV
  • 25fec32589ddf1a14da0eb43fc7ed183d59bc9c788a2ef3664c2839d1ff09eff:1
  • value  334561962
    address  35X5n3thgGoTSbjZoUbugpt7hH7KRvr8mQ